DOCUMENTATION = '''
---
module: os_object
short_description: Create or Delete objects and containers from OpenStack
version_added: "2.0"
author: "Monty Taylor (@emonty)"
extends_documentation_fragment: openstack
description:
- Create or Delete objects and containers from OpenStack
options:
container:
description:
- The name of the container in which to create the object
required: true
name:
description:
- Name to be give to the object. If omitted, operations will be on
the entire container
required: false
filename:
description:
- Path to local file to be uploaded.
required: false
container_access:
description:
- desired container access level.
required: false
choices: ['private', 'public']
default: private
state:
description:
- Should the resource be present or absent.
choices: [present, absent]
default: present
availability_zone:
description:
- Ignored. Present for backwards compatibility
required: false
'''
EXAMPLES = '''
- name: "Create a object named 'fstab' in the 'config' container"
os_object:
cloud: mordred
state: present
name: fstab
container: config
filename: /etc/fstab
- name: Delete a container called config and all of its contents
os_object:
cloud: rax-iad
state: absent
container: config
'''

def process_object(
cloud_obj, container, name, filename, container_access, **kwargs):
changed = False
container_obj = cloud_obj.get_container(container)
if kwargs['state'] == 'present':
if not container_obj:
container_obj = cloud_obj.create_container(container)
changed = True
if cloud_obj.get_container_access(container) != container_access:
cloud_obj.set_container_access(container, container_access)
changed = True
if name:
if cloud_obj.is_object_stale(container, name, filename):
cloud_obj.create_object(container, name, filename)
changed = True
else:
if container_obj:
if name:
if cloud_obj.get_object_metadata(container, name):
cloud_obj.delete_object(container, name)
changed = True
else:
cloud_obj.delete_container(container)
changed = True
return changed
